This is the low down; A group of B-list celebrities is stranded in Costa Rica, with their fate in the hands of viewers in this retooling of the British reality show. The celebrities compete in survival-themed challenges to earn extra food, supplies and luxury items, and viewers vote them off the show one by one.
Although former Illinois Gov. Rod Blagojevich had been asked to take part in the new season on NBC, a judge refused him permission to leave the country while awaiting trial on corruption charges. The last celebrity standing wins cash to be donated to his or her favorite charity.
